源数据包

链接:https://pan.baidu.com/s/1jVqX-WUkwSWZA0J3b-DnFg 
提取码:1111 
复制这段内容后打开百度网盘手机App,操作更方便哦

import pandas as pd
import numpy as np
from sklearn.metrics import confusion_matrix
from sklearn.model_selection import train_test_split
from sklearn.tree import DecisionTreeClassifier
from sklearn.model_selection import GridSearchCV
from sklearn import metrics
from sklearn.neighbors import KNeighborsRegressor
from sklearn.metrics import mean_squared_error  # 评价指标

特征数值化

def read_dataset(data_link):data = pd.read_csv(data_link, index_col=0)  # 读取数据集,取第一列为索引data.drop(['Name', 'Ticket', 'Cabin'], axis=1, inplace=True) # 删除掉三个无关紧要的特征labels = data['Sex'].unique().tolist()data['Sex'] = [*map(lambda x: labels.index(x), data['Sex'])] # 将字符串数值化labels = data['Embarked'].unique().tolist()

泰坦尼克号生还者预测机器学习二分类算法+LSTM+GRU ()相关推荐

  1. 经典的机器学习二分类算法——Logistic回归

    问题描述 对于维度为m+1m+1m+1特征为xxx样本的二分类问题,有负类(Negative Class)记为0" role="presentation" style=& ...

  2. EL之DTRFGBT:基于三种算法(DT、RF、GBT)对泰坦尼克号乘客数据集进行二分类(是否获救)预测并对比各自性能

    EL之DT&RF&GBT:基于三种算法(DT.RF.GBT)对泰坦尼克号乘客数据集进行二分类(是否获救)预测并对比各自性能 目录 输出结果 ​设计思路 核心代码 输出结果 设计思路 核 ...

  3. ML之DT:基于DT算法对泰坦尼克号乘客数据集进行二分类(是否获救)预测

    ML之DT:基于DT算法对泰坦尼克号乘客数据集进行二分类(是否获救)预测 目录 输出结果 设计思路 核心代码 输出结果 设计思路 核心代码 X_train, X_test, y_train, y_te ...

  4. 【数据分析师-数据分析项目案例二】泰坦尼克号生还者预测案例

    泰坦尼克号生还者预测案例 1 数据 1.1 数据下载 1.2 数据字段介绍 2 数据加载和基本的ETL 2.1 模块导入和数据加载 2.2 数据清洗 2.2.1 缺失值处理 2.2.2 分类数据独热编 ...

  5. [Python从零到壹] 十四.机器学习之分类算法五万字总结全网首发(决策树、KNN、SVM、分类对比实验)

    欢迎大家来到"Python从零到壹",在这里我将分享约200篇Python系列文章,带大家一起去学习和玩耍,看看Python这个有趣的世界.所有文章都将结合案例.代码和作者的经验讲 ...

  6. 机器学习分类算法_达观数据:5分钟带你理解机器学习及分类算法

    1.本文介绍内容:什么是机器学习,机器学习有哪些分类算法,分类算法之k-近邻,决策树,随机森林2.本文适合人群:本文通过通俗易懂的语言和例子介绍核心思想,不拽高大上的名词,适合于不懂机器学习的小白3. ...

  7. 深入理解GBDT二分类算法

    我的个人微信公众号: Microstrong 微信公众号ID: MicrostrongAI 微信公众号介绍: Microstrong(小强)同学主要研究机器学习.深度学习.计算机视觉.智能对话系统相关 ...

  8. 深入解析GBDT二分类算法(附代码实现)

    目录: GBDT分类算法简介 GBDT二分类算法 2.1 逻辑回归的对数损失函数 2.2 GBDT二分类原理 GBDT二分类算法实例 手撕GBDT二分类算法 4.1 用Python3实现GBDT二分类 ...

  9. 「二分类算法」提供银行精准营销解决方案(各个模型汇总分析)baseline

    完整代码见 Github:「二分类算法」提供银行精准营销解决方案 赛事详情 1.比赛页面:「二分类算法」提供银行精准营销解决方案 2.数据与测评算法 训练集下载链接 测试集下载链接 字段说明 测评算法 ...

最新文章

  1. 算法 - 时间复杂度
  2. XML 特殊字符处理和 CDATA
  3. 基于BP弱分类器用Adaboost的强分类器
  4. 在集群的操作机上执行命令为什么会出现权限被拒绝_如何使用 TDengine 2.0 最新开源的集群功能?
  5. 简单地发布EJB程序的过程
  6. C++文件操作之get/getline(待学)
  7. erp系统方案书_解决方案 |快普M8为系统集成企业定制的ERP系统
  8. vue -- 动态加载组件 (tap 栏效果)
  9. 宁波医院计算机试题及答案,(宁波市第25届小学生计算机程序设计竞赛试题及答案.doc...
  10. c++ error函数_Linux中create_elf_tables函数整型溢出漏洞分析(CVE201814634)
  11. pyqtsignal()作用
  12. 用傅里叶分析得到频域信息 MATLAB,信号频谱分析
  13. 一级计算机基础试题答案,计算机一级计算机基础试题及答案
  14. VC2012编译protobuf出错处理
  15. POJ 1252 Euro Efficiency G++ 完全背包 背
  16. 接收灵敏度和等效噪声带宽(ENBW)
  17. [RFID]射频识别技术基础
  18. Element Plus的分页组件el-pagination显示英文
  19. GNOME 3 使用技巧
  20. 蒙特卡洛方法到底有什么用

热门文章

  1. iPhone3开发基础教程中部分有用代码片段(1)
  2. 用户输入生产日期和保质期(月),计算商品的促销日期
  3. QeePHP中上传多个文件的基础写法
  4. 【图文教程】CAD 卸载工具(免费),教你卸载CAD
  5. (建议收藏)TCP协议灵魂之问,巩固你的网路底层基础
  6. 华为T8951驱动安装
  7. 城镇智慧水务平台初步设计方案
  8. Android图片处理二:PhotoView源码解析
  9. 计算机高手是怎么炼成的
  10. Python入门一头雾水